Talinum calycinum

 

Botanical Name: Talinum calycinum

Hardiness Zone: 6

Heat Zone: 4-9

Flower Color: Rose-Pink

Bloom Time: June-October

Foliage Color: Green

Winter Interest: No

Height: 12”     

Spread: 7”

Drought Tolerance: Very High

Moisture Tolerance: No

Shade Tolerance: No

N. American Native: Yes

 

 

An American native widely distributed through the mid-west, it self sows freely, but doesn't displace other ground covers, rather grows in between. Flowers every afternoon once it starts from May to September.
